How-to: Find communities and subscribe to them - lemdit.com

Finding awesome communities and subscribing to them is likely one of the first things you want to do in Lemmy. It can also be a bit confusing. This guide will walk you through how it works and hopefully improve your experience. The beautiful thing about the Fediverse is you can interact with all federated content from the comfort of your home Lemmy instance. Since the best communities may not natively reside on the server you’re on, the easiest way to discover them is by using one of these awesome 3rd party explorers: - https://lemmyverse.net/communities [https://lemmyverse.net/communities] - https://browse.feddit.de/ [https://browse.feddit.de/] Using https://lemmyverse.net/communities [https://lemmyverse.net/communities] — 1. Once you’ve found an interesting community, click on the community Lemmy link to copy it: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/14253359-c1b7-4d29-8fb8-1cf2b17623f2.png] 2. On your home Lemmy instance, click on Search (the magnifying glass) on the top-right of your screen: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/3acae741-95a4-48a2-a5ed-8340e6643489.png] 3. Paste the link into the search box and click the Search button: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/4ccc0c61-a174-4b21-83d7-13f73119706f.png] 4. Wait! It can take Lemmy a bit of time to find the community. If nothing shows up after 10-20 seconds, try clicking Search again. 5. Click on the search result to open the community inside of your Lemmy instance: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/dc8d07aa-981d-4212-ac35-7a1542a1542e.png] 6. The community page wil open up and you can now click the Subscribe button on the right-hand side: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/46d126bc-5ba5-4b70-a318-47b3b9f84198.png] 7. Sometimes nothing seems to happen after you hit Subscribe. This is a known Lemmy bug at the moment. Refresh the page 10 seconds later and it should show you as joined: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/aeda4064-ad79-4c9d-aa7c-fab538c2b3eb.png] — Using https://browse.feddit.de/ [https://browse.feddit.de/] — 1. Once you’ve found an interesting community, click on the copy link button: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/0aeb15b6-d379-4c26-b184-338f0721dd32.png] 2. Follow the same steps as described for https://lemmyverse.net/communities [https://lemmyverse.net/communities] The only difference is the link you copied is the actual URL for the community page, rather than its Lemmy community link (https://lemmy.world/c/world [https://lemmy.world/c/world] in this example). — Using your browser — 1. Copy the community URL from your browser’s address bar: [https://lemdit.com/pictrs/image/9b20b62f-b7da-4352-b576-d26ef8cc9ac1.png] 2. Follow the same steps as described for https://lemmyverse.net/communities [https://lemmyverse.net/communities] — I hope you found this guide useful.
